Bitfarms Enters into a Binding LOI with HIVE Digital Technologies for the Sale of its Yguazu, Paraguay Site
Portfolio Pulse from
Bitfarms has entered into a binding letter of intent with HIVE Digital Technologies to sell its Yguazu site in Paraguay for approximately $85 million. The transaction will allow Bitfarms to reinvest in US growth opportunities, reduce 2025 capital requirements, and lower power costs by 10%.
